Transaction e552017cde93a3ed7ec28c0944b6610bff2f7a91b66fb09a2d00011caa3ae879
1 Input
1 Output
-
e552017cde93a3ed7ec28c0944b6610bff2f7a91b66fb09a2d00011caa3ae879:0
- value
- 21794993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bbfd2de901400ea9e4dcecbdab1c61550d3150f OP_EQUAL
- address
- 3FtYTRTCE8q7kcWbwMvzzWv6PgUPSJgMHD